How much is 60L in USA?


60 GBP = $107 USD.


Our kittens are $100 - altered, vaccinated, and Revolutioned, and tested for
FeLV.

Consider a neuter runs around $80, spays a little more, vaccinations run
about $15 a pop for just FVRCP - if we have them long enough, they get
boostered as well. FeLV tests aren't cheap, either.

I've spent that several times on rescue cats. Cats run $60
at local shelters. Unless the SPCA is having a "sale" and then
it's $25.


Our shelters run anywhere from $50 in the city (kill shelter) to $150 at

some
of the no-kill, non-profit shelters (the rare ones that are cageless, have
lots of volunteers, scheduled playtimes, and so on). I'd say $75 is pretty
average.
Considering the fact that when I had my cat spayed, it cost me $150, I'd

say
getting an already neutered cat for less than that is a bargain. Plus

costs
of vaccinations, wormings, and so on.
